The TDPSA grants Texas residents rights to access, correct, delete, and opt out of the sale or targeted advertising of personal information, effective July 1, 2024. Universal opt-out mechanisms (e.g., Global Privacy Control) will be honored starting January 1, 2025.
California residents have specific rights regarding their personal information, including the right to know, delete, correct, and limit the use of their personal information.
Virginia residents have rights to access, correct, delete, and obtain a copy of their personal information, as well as opt out of certain processing activities.
